The Hampton University women’s indoor track and field team finished second at the CAA Championships, which took place at the TRACK at New Balance in Boston on Sunday. Hampton scored 121.5 points, placing behind Elon University, which led with 135 points. N.C. A&T came in third with 93 points, narrowly surpassing Towson’s 92 points.

Brianna Charles was named Track Athlete of the Meet after securing first place in both the 60 meters (7.38) and the 200 meters (23.47), achieving personal bests in each event. She also contributed to Hampton’s third-place finish in the 4×400 relay, which clocked a time of 3:49.29.

Hampton set a meet record in the 4×800 relay as Shari Brown, Avah Savage, Mekayla Wilson, and Kylee King completed the race in 8:55.50.

In other events, Hampton collected significant points across multiple disciplines:
– In the 200 meters, Charles’s win was followed by Nyla Felton in fourth place (24.14) and Morgan Pruitt in fifth (24.22), giving Hampton a total of 19 points.
– The team earned 16 points in the 400 meters with Felton finishing second (55.14), Arriah Gilmer fourth (55.63), Olayinka Yetunde seventh (56.20), and Laila Carpenter eighth (56.36).
– In the 800 meters, King finished fourth (2:09.74), Nia Warren fifth (2:09.77), Wilson sixth (2:10.32), and Savage seventh (2:10.42).
– Danielle James won a CAA title in long jump with a mark of 6.06m; Caylie Jefferson placed sixth at 5.82m.
– Rochele Solmon added another individual title for Hampton by winning shot put with a throw of 15.10m.
– James also took second place in triple jump with a leap of 12.26m; Arden Gray was eighth at 11.75m.
– Saniyah Evans finished sixth in the 60 hurdles with a time of 8.72 seconds.
– Damali Williams secured sixth place in weight throw with a toss of 17.37m.
– DeAuna Louis placed eighth overall in pentathlon with a total score of 3,293 points.
